Movies have been an integral part of our culture for over a century, entertaining, inspiring, and challenging us in relyless ways. Whether or not you're a casual moviegoer or a dedicated cinephile, understanding easy methods to consider and recognize films can enrich your cinematic experience. Film criticism is the artwork of analyzing and deciphering films, shedding light on their inventive merits, cultural significance, and emotional impact. In this article, we'll explore the key elements of film criticism and provide you with recommendations on how you can change into a more discerning and appreciative film viewer.

 

 

 

 

Story and Screenplay

 

 

A powerful foundation is essential for any film, and that begins with the story and screenplay. Analyze the plot's structure, character development, and narrative arc. Consider whether the storyline is engaging and if it successfully conveys the meant message or theme. A well-crafted screenplay ought to captivate your consideration, evoke emotions, and depart you with something to ponder long after the credits roll.

 

 

 

 

Direction and Cinematography

 

 

The director's vision and the cinematographer's skill play a pivotal role in shaping a film's visual identity. Take note of the framing, composition, lighting, and camera movements. A skilled director can manipulate these elements to create temper, build tension, or emphasize particular themes. Consider how the visual points enhance or detract from the general storytelling.

 

 

 

 

Appearing and Performances

 

 

Appearing is a critical element of any film. Assess the performances of the cast, specializing in their ability to bring characters to life, convey emotions, and establish believable connections on screen. Great appearing can transport you into the world of the film, making you neglect that you just're watching a performance.

 

 

 

 

Editing and Pacing

 

 

Editing determines the rhythm and pacing of a film. Look for seamless transitions between scenes and how the editing contributes to the narrative flow. Analyze the use of cuts, transitions, and montages to see in the event that they effectively convey information or emotions. Pacing can greatly impact your interactment with a film; it should align with the story's needs.

 

 

 

 

Sound and Music

 

 

Sound design and music have a profound impact on the emotional resonance of a film. Evaluate the quality of the sound effects and the appropriateness of the soundtrack. Consider how the auditory elements enhance the storytelling, create stress, or evoke specific feelings. A well-composed score can elevate a film to a whole new level.

 

 

 

 

Themes and Symbolism

 

 

Many films comprise underlying themes and symbolism that require thoughtful analysis. Explore the deeper which means of a film, being attentive to recurring motifs, allegorical elements, and social commentary. A film could be a highly effective medium for exploring advanced ideas and societal issues.

 

 

 

 

Historical and Cultural Context

 

 

Understanding the historical and cultural context of a film can provide valuable insights into its significance. Consider the time interval in which it was made, the prevailing societal norms, and the filmmaker's background. This context can shed light on the film's themes and messages, helping you recognize it on a deeper level.

 

 

 

 

Personal Impact

 

 

Film criticism is a subjective endeavor, and your personal connection with a movie matters. Mirror on how a film resonated with you emotionally and intellectually. Did it challenge your beliefs, make you laugh, or convey tears to your eyes? Your personal reactions and experiences are an essential part of evaluating and appreciating movies.

 

 

 

 

Comparative Analysis

 

 

To refine your film criticism skills, compare and distinction different motion pictures within the identical genre or by the identical director. Analyze how filmmakers tackle comparable themes or storytelling methods and the way their approaches differ. This observe might help you develop a more nuanced understanding of filmmaking.

 

 

 

 

Continuous Learning

 

 

Film criticism is a dynamic field, with new films and views rising regularly. Keep engaged with the world of cinema by reading opinions, watching interviews with filmmakers, and participating in discussions with fellow movie enthusiasts. The more you immerse your self on the earth of film, the more adept you will grow to be at evaluating and appreciating movies.

 

 

 

 

In conclusion, film criticism is a rewarding pursuit that enhances your ability to have interaction with and recognize the artwork of cinema. By inspecting the story, direction, performances, and various elements that contribute to a film's impact, you'll be able to develop a deeper understanding of the medium and grow to be a more discerning viewer. So, the subsequent time you watch a film, take a moment to analyze and respect the craftsmanship that goes into creating this powerful and influential form of art.
